  • A temple and monastery of the Geluk School of Tibetan Buddhism, it lies on Beijing's central North/South axis. The monastery was a residence for large numbers of Tibetan Buddhist monks from Mongolia and Tibet and thus the Yonghe Lamasery was the national center of Lama administration.
